Font Notes:
The present font in this church consists of a tub-shaped basin appears modern and is decorated with a thick rope moulding around its middle; it is raised on a re-cycled (?) square block decorated with a deeply-carved arch-head on each side; a square lower base cut to match the shape of the upper base. It is a strange combination of three stone blocks, certainly a composite object; is it possible that the basin may have been re-carved from an earlier font? The metal cover is modern.
